Output 38885526fc81393fd60ae70f53879044ba99bafe1cb2bef53889f162f24c462c:0

value
1015109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e3a0aaa5f3b3d04b180e804e5087abd4f28acf OP_EQUAL
address
MJjneuhMrDxcz9XhKyBEr34WLU8geoQVFA
transaction
38885526fc81393fd60ae70f53879044ba99bafe1cb2bef53889f162f24c462c
spent
true